Nova Bot Nova Bot is a Telegram-based Solana trading bot offering fast execution for buying and selling tokens directly from chat. GetBlock GetBlock is a multi-chain RPC node provider that gives developers API access to blockchain networks, including Solana, through both shared and dedicated nodes. Nova Bot's key strengths include quick execution from telegram, solid wallet management features, growing user base. GetBlock stands out for broad multi-chain coverage, free tier to start, dedicated nodes for heavy workloads. On the flip side, Nova Bot's weaknesses include 1% transaction fee, while GetBlock's main drawback is general provider, solana is one of 100+ chains.
